Attribute Based Access Control

Developers should learn ABAC when building systems requiring complex, context-aware security policies, such as in cloud environments, healthcare applications, or financial services where access depends on multiple variables like user roles, data sensitivity, time, or location

Pros

  • +It is particularly useful for implementing least-privilege access and compliance with regulations like GDPR or HIPAA, as it allows dynamic policy adjustments without restructuring user roles

Context-Aware Security

Developers should learn context-aware security when building applications that require fine-grained access control, such as enterprise systems, financial platforms, or healthcare apps, where security needs vary based on context like user role or location

Pros

  • +It is particularly useful in modern environments with mobile devices, cloud services, and IoT, where static security rules are insufficient to handle dynamic threats and user scenarios
